Merrylands - Holroyd's government schools have an average ICSEA of 948, compared to 1,000 in Glendale - Cardiff - Hillsborough. ICSEA reflects the socioeconomic intake of students, not teaching quality - it is not a ranking of school performance.
Catholic/independent schools are separate from the free government catchment - average ICSEA Merrylands - Holroyd 1,050 (1 school), Glendale - Cardiff - Hillsborough 1,072 (4 schools).
There are 6 schools in Merrylands - Holroyd, compared to 13 in Glendale - Cardiff - Hillsborough.
Childcare services matched by suburb name: 37 in Merrylands - Holroyd vs 25 in Glendale - Cardiff - Hillsborough.
The proportion of children from non-English-speaking backgrounds is higher in Merrylands - Holroyd at 70.1% (vs 6.5% in Glendale - Cardiff - Hillsborough).
Merrylands - Holroyd has a SEIFA advantage (IRSAD) of Decile 3, below Glendale - Cardiff - Hillsborough's Decile 5. Decile 10 is the most advantaged nationally.
Median house prices are 44% higher in Merrylands - Holroyd ($1.39M vs $965,000).
